Springe zu einem wichtigen Kapitel
Was ist Sprachverarbeitung in Robotik?
Die Sprachverarbeitung in Robotik umfasst Technologien, die es Robotern ermöglichen, menschliche Sprache zu verstehen und darauf zu reagieren. Es ist ein faszinierendes Feld, das an der Schnittstelle von Computertechnik, Künstlicher Intelligenz (KI) und Linguistik operiert.
Sprachverarbeitung in der Robotik Definition
Sprachverarbeitung in der Robotik bezieht sich auf die Anwendung von Algorithmen und Technologien, die es Robotern oder automatisierten Systemen erlauben, menschliche Sprache in Form von gesprochenen Worten zu interpretieren, darauf zu antworten und in einigen Fällen sogar in einer menschenähnlichen Weise zu kommunizieren.
Grundlagen der Sprachverarbeitung in Robotik
Die Grundlagen der Sprachverarbeitung in Robotik basieren auf mehreren Kernelementen:
- Automatische Spracherkennung (ASR): Die Umwandlung gesprochener Sprache in Text.
- Natürliche Sprachverarbeitung (NLP): Die Verarbeitung und das Verständnis menschlicher Sprache durch Maschinen.
- Sprachsynthese: Die Erzeugung gesprochener Sprache aus Text.
NLP verwendet oft maschinelles Lernen, um Sprachmuster zu verstehen und zu interpretieren.
Wie funktioniert Sprachverarbeitung in Robotik?
Um zu verstehen, wie Sprachverarbeitung in Robotik funktioniert, ist es hilfreich, den Prozess in mehrere Schritte zu unterteilen:
- Erfassung der Sprache durch ein Mikrofon.
- Umwandlung der erfassten Audio-Daten in ein digitales Format.
- Anwendung der automatischen Spracherkennung (ASR), um gesprochene Sprache in Text umzuwandeln.
- Verwendung von natürlicher Sprachverarbeitung (NLP), um den Text zu analysieren und dessen Bedeutung zu verstehen.
- Einleitung entsprechender Aktionen oder Reaktionen des Roboters basierend auf der Interpretation.
- Sprachsynthese, um eine verbale Antwort vom Roboter zu generieren, wenn nötig.
Ein praktisches Beispiel für Sprachverarbeitung in Robotik ist ein Chatbot oder ein virtueller Assistent wie Amazons Alexa oder Apples Siri. Diese Systeme erkennen Benutzeranfragen in natürlicher Sprache, interpretieren diese und geben eine passende Antwort in gesprochener Form.
Maschinelles Lernen spielt eine zentrale Rolle in der fortgeschrittenen Sprachverarbeitung, um die Genauigkeit der Spracherkennung und des Verständnisses zu verbessern. Typischerweise werden riesige Datensätze mit menschlicher Sprache analysiert, um Muster zu identifizieren und Algorithmen zu trainieren, die in der Lage sind, mit einer Vielzahl von Akzenten, Dialekten und Sprachmodellen umzugehen. Dies ermöglicht eine natürlichere und effizientere Interaktion zwischen Mensch und Maschine.
Sprachverarbeitung in Robotik einfach erklärt
Die Sprachverarbeitung in Robotik verwandelt die Art und Weise, wie Menschen mit Maschinen interagieren, grundlegend. Durch die Entwicklung und Anwendung von Techniken zur Analyse und Interpretation menschlicher Sprache öffnen sich neue Türen zur Roboterautomatisierung und Intelligenz.
Die Rolle der Sprachverarbeitung in Robotik
In der Robotik spielt die Sprachverarbeitung eine entscheidende Rolle, um die Interaktion zwischen Mensch und Maschine zu vereinfachen und zu verbessern. Sie ermöglicht es Robotern, gesprochene Sprache zu verstehen, zu interpretieren und darauf zu reagieren, wodurch sie benutzerfreundlicher und effektiver in ihrem Einsatz werden.
Durch die Integration von Sprachverarbeitungstechnologien können Roboter:
- Auf Sprachbefehle reagieren
- Gegebene Aufgaben verstehen und ausführen
- Menschliche Emotionen und Absichten besser erkennen
- Informationen bereitstellen oder Fragen beantworten
Sprachverarbeitung in Robotik bildet die Brücke für eine natürlichere und intuitive Kommunikation zwischen Mensch und Technologie.
Technologien der Sprachverarbeitung in Robotik
Die Umsetzung der Sprachverarbeitung in Robotik stützt sich auf eine Kombination fortschrittlicher Technologien, die das Herzstück für das Verständnis und die Generierung menschlicher Sprache bilden.
Hier sind einige der Schlüsseltechnologien und ihre Funktionen:
Technologie | Funktion |
Automatische Spracherkennung (ASR) | Wandelt gesprochene Sprache in Text um |
Natürliche Sprachverarbeitung (NLP) | Analyse und Interpretation des Textes |
Sprachsynthese | Erzeugung von gesprochener Sprache aus Text |
Jede dieser Technologien trägt dazu bei, die Effizienz und Effektivität der Sprachverarbeitung in Robotik zu erhöhen. ASR ermöglicht die Erfassung und Übersetzung gesprochener Worte in Schriftform, NLP unterstützt die Maschine bei der Verarbeitung und Interpretation dieser Texte, und Sprachsynthese ermöglicht es dem Roboter, auf natürliche Weise zu antworten.
Ein Beispiel für die Anwendung dieser Technologien ist ein Roboter-Assistent in Haushalten, der auf Sprachbefehle wie "Schalte das Licht ein" reagieren kann. Der Prozess involviert:
- ASR, um den Befehl zu erkennen und in Text umzuwandeln,
- NLP, um den Befehl zu analysieren und dessen Intention zu verstehen,
- und schließlich die Anweisung ausführt sowie mittels Sprachsynthese eine Bestätigung ausspricht.
Um die Herausforderungen in der Sprachverarbeitung zu meistern, setzen Forscher zunehmend auf Deep Learning und Neuronale Netze. Diese Techniken ermöglichen es Robotern, menschliche Sprachmuster besser zu erkennen und sich an verschiedene Akzente, Dialekte oder gesprochene Nuancen anzupassen. Die kontinuierliche Verbesserung dieser Technologien führt zu einer immer natürlicheren und flüssigeren Kommunikation zwischen Menschen und Maschinen.
Übung zur Sprachverarbeitung in Robotik
Die Sprachverarbeitung in Robotik ist ein aufstrebendes Feld, das Technik und Sprache vereint, um Maschinen zu befähigen, menschliche Sprache zu verstehen und zu interpretieren. Durch praktische Übungen kann das Verständnis für die Sprachverarbeitung vertieft und angewendet werden.
Sprachverarbeitung Robotik Übung - Einfache Beispiele
Für den Einstieg in die Sprachverarbeitung in der Robotik sind einfache Übungen sehr hilfreich. Sie ermöglichen es, grundlegende Konzepte und Technologien praktisch zu erproben. Hier einige Beispiele:
Erstelle einen einfachen Sprachassistenten, der Grundbefehle versteht:
import speech_recognition as sr recognizer = sr.Recognizer() with sr.Microphone() as source: print("Sprich etwas:") audio = recognizer.listen(source) try: text = recognizer.recognize_google(audio, language='de-DE') print("Du hast gesagt: " + text) except sr.UnknownValueError: print("Google Speech Recognition konnte dich nicht verstehen") except sr.RequestError as e: print("Konnte keine Anfrage an Google Speech Recognition senden; {0}".format(e))
Beginne mit einfachen Sprachbefehlen, um die Komplexität schrittweise zu steigern.
Anleitungen zur Vertiefung deiner Kenntnisse in Sprachverarbeitung
Um deine Fähigkeiten in der Sprachverarbeitung in Robotik weiterzuentwickeln, ist es wichtig, regelmäßig zu üben und neue Konzepte zu erkunden. Nachfolgend findest du einige Anleitungen, die dir dabei helfen können:
- Experimentiere mit verschiedenen Spracherkennungsbibliotheken und vergleiche ihre Leistung.
- Entwickle eine Anwendung, die Sprachbefehle nutzt, um physische Aktionen eines Roboters zu steuern.
- Vertiefe dein Wissen in Natürliche Sprachverarbeitung (NLP), indem du dich mit Textanalyse und -verarbeitung beschäftigst.
- Nutze Online-Kurse und -Workshops, die sich auf KI, maschinelles Lernen und Robotik spezialisieren.
Ein tieferes Verständnis für NLP-Techniken ermöglicht es dir, komplexere Herausforderungen in der Sprachverarbeitung zu meistern. Dazu gehört das Training von Modellen für Spracherkennung, die effektive Verwendung von Kontext in der Sprachverarbeitung und das Verstehen von Semantik und Syntax in menschlicher Sprache. Die kontinuierliche Beschäftigung mit aktuellen Forschungsergebnissen und der Austausch mit der Community können enorm zur Vertiefung deines Wissens beitragen.
Anwendungsbeispiele für Sprachverarbeitung in Robotik
Die Anwendung von Sprachverarbeitung in der Robotik hat das Potenzial, viele Bereiche des täglichen Lebens und der Arbeit zu revolutionieren. Durch den Einsatz dieser Technologie können Roboter Sprachbefehle verstehen und ausführen, was zu einer effizienteren und benutzerfreundlicheren Interaktion führt.
Praktische Beispiele der Sprachverarbeitung in Robotik
In der Praxis findet die Sprachverarbeitung in der Robotik vielfältige Anwendungen:
- Interaktive Spielzeuge, die auf Sprachbefehle von Kindern reagieren können
- Persönliche Assistenten wie Roboterstaubsauger, die durch sprachliche Anweisungen gesteuert werden
- Unterstützungsroboter in der Pflege, die einfache Konversationen führen und Anweisungen entgegennehmen können
Diese Beispiele zeigen, wie Sprachverarbeitung in der Robotik dazu beiträgt, die Interaktion zwischen Menschen und Maschinen natürlicher und intuitiver zu gestalten.
Sprachgesteuerte Systeme in Robotern können auch dazu verwendet werden, den Alltag von Menschen mit körperlichen Einschränkungen zu erleichtern, indem sie ihnen ermöglichen, Geräte und Hilfsmittel mittels Sprachbefehlen zu steuern.
Wie Sprachverarbeitung Robotik in der Industrie revolutioniert
In der Industrie führt die Integration von Sprachverarbeitung in Robotiksysteme zu einer erheblichen Steigerung der Effizienz und Sicherheit. Einige Schlüsselbereiche sind:
- Automatisierte Kundendienstzentren, in denen Roboter Anrufe entgegennehmen und durch Spracherkennung Kundenanliegen bearbeiten
- Produktionsroboter, die durch sprachliche Kommandos gesteuert werden, wodurch die Bedienung komplexer Maschinen vereinfacht wird
- Überwachungsroboter, die auf spezifische akustische Signale oder Befehle reagieren können
Diese Entwicklungen zeigen, dass die Sprachverarbeitung in der Robotik nicht nur die Art und Weise, wie Aufgaben und Prozesse gesteuert werden, verändert, sondern auch neue Möglichkeiten für die Automatisierung und Interaktion schafft.
Ein Beispiel dafür, wie Sprachverarbeitung die Industrie revolutioniert, ist ein Lagerverwaltungssystem, das Robotereinheiten verwendet, um Waren zu sortieren und zu verlagern. Mitarbeiter können die Roboter durch einfache Sprachbefehle steuern, wodurch Arbeitsabläufe beschleunigt und menschliche Fehler reduziert werden. So könnte ein Sprachbefehl lauten:
'Lagerroboter, verlagere Produkt A von Zone 3 nach Zone 5.'
Der Schlüssel zur Integration von Sprachverarbeitung in der Robotik liegt in der Entwicklung fortschrittlicher natürlicher Sprachverarbeitungs- (NLP) und maschineller Lernalgorithmen. Diese Technologien ermöglichen es Robotern, nicht nur Befehle zu verstehen, sondern auch den Kontext und die Absichten hinter den Anweisungen zu erkennen. Die ständige Verbesserung der Spracherkennungsrate und die Fähigkeit, verschiedene Dialekte, Akzente und Sprachen zu verstehen, sind entscheidend für die Weiterentwicklung sprachgesteuerter Robotersysteme in industriellen Anwendungen.
Sprachverarbeitung in Robotik - Das Wichtigste
- Die Sprachverarbeitung in Robotik umfasst Technologien zum Verstehen und Reagieren auf menschliche Sprache an der Schnittstelle von Computertechnik, KI und Linguistik.
- Sprachverarbeitung in der Robotik Definition: Anwendung von Algorithmen und Technologien zur Interpretation und Reaktion auf gesprochene Worte.
- Grundlagen der Sprachverarbeitung in Robotik beinhalten Automatische Spracherkennung (ASR), Natürliche Sprachverarbeitung (NLP) und Sprachsynthese.
- Der Prozess der Sprachverarbeitung in Robotik beinhaltet Sprache erfassen, digital umwandeln, mittels ASR in Text überführen, durch NLP analysieren und durch den Roboter reagieren oder agieren.
- Anwendungsbeispiele der Sprachverarbeitung in Robotik umfassen Chatbots, virtuelle Assistenten wie Alexa oder Siri und Roboter-Assistenten in Haushalten.
- Technologien der Sprachverarbeitung in Robotik umfassen ASR zur Umwandlung von Sprache in Text, NLP zur Textanalyse und -interpretation sowie Sprachsynthese zur gesprochenen Kommunikation.
Lerne schneller mit den 12 Karteikarten zu Sprachverarbeitung in Robotik
Melde dich kostenlos an, um Zugriff auf all unsere Karteikarten zu erhalten.
Häufig gestellte Fragen zum Thema Sprachverarbeitung in Robotik
Über StudySmarter
StudySmarter ist ein weltweit anerkanntes Bildungstechnologie-Unternehmen, das eine ganzheitliche Lernplattform für Schüler und Studenten aller Altersstufen und Bildungsniveaus bietet. Unsere Plattform unterstützt das Lernen in einer breiten Palette von Fächern, einschließlich MINT, Sozialwissenschaften und Sprachen, und hilft den Schülern auch, weltweit verschiedene Tests und Prüfungen wie GCSE, A Level, SAT, ACT, Abitur und mehr erfolgreich zu meistern. Wir bieten eine umfangreiche Bibliothek von Lernmaterialien, einschließlich interaktiver Karteikarten, umfassender Lehrbuchlösungen und detaillierter Erklärungen. Die fortschrittliche Technologie und Werkzeuge, die wir zur Verfügung stellen, helfen Schülern, ihre eigenen Lernmaterialien zu erstellen. Die Inhalte von StudySmarter sind nicht nur von Experten geprüft, sondern werden auch regelmäßig aktualisiert, um Genauigkeit und Relevanz zu gewährleisten.
Erfahre mehr